- The first thing you need is a sharp knife and a large turnip. You bore a hole through the turnip and put a stick through the turnip for the axle. Next you take the knife and cut tracks across the turnip like the wooden trows on a real wheel.Now you fix it across a place where water falls and it can run quote nicely.
